Understanding Soffits: What Are They?
Soffits are the horizontal panels located underneath the edge of a roof overhang. They help to cover the rafters of a roof and are usually made from products like wood, vinyl, aluminum, or composite materials. Soffits play an important role in supplying airflow to the attic and safeguarding the roof structure.

Installing soffits typically includes several steps. Whether you start a DIY job or work with professionals, the following procedure outlines what to anticipate.
1. Planning and Measurement
Before setup, accurate measurements of the roof overhang are required. Soffit installers will usually:
Measure the length of the eaves.Figure out the quantity of product required.Choose the suitable type and color of soffit product.2. Preparing the Area
The location where the soffit will be set up should be cleaned and cleared. This might include:
Removing old soffit product (if relevant).Looking for any indications of damage or pests, which must be resolved prior to setup.3. Ventilation Considerations
Throughout installation, it's critical to ensure that the Soffits And Guttering permit for appropriate airflow. Soffit installers may:
Choose vented soffit panels for Fascias Solutions increased ventilation.Determine the required vent space based on the attic size and roof structure.4. Installation
The actual installation procedure can vary by product but generally follows these actions:
Cut the soffit panels to size.Secure them in place, either by nailing or using an attaching system, depending upon the material.Ensure that panels are aligned correctly for a neat surface.5. Ending up Touches
Once the panels are set up:
Seal any gaps with caulk or trim.Paint or end up as required, particularly for wood soffits.Why Hire Professional Soffit Installers?

Q2: How long do soffits last?
The lifespan of soffits differs by material. Vinyl soffits can last approximately 30 years, while aluminum and wood need more regular maintenance and could last anywhere from 10 to 20 years depending on their care and environmental factors.
